The pharmaceutical arena is undergoing a profound transformation thanks to the growth of artificial intelligence (AI). AI-powered platforms are disrupting drug discovery by analyzing massive datasets, identifying novel targets, and improving the development of treatments. This boost in efficiency offers to shorten the time required to bring life-saving drugs to market, consequently improving patient outcomes.

  • AI algorithms can scrutinize vast libraries of structures, discovering promising candidates for drug development.
  • Machine learning can estimate the performance of drug candidates before they enter clinical trials, saving time and resources.
  • AI-powered platforms can personalize treatment approaches based on a patient's individual biological profile, leading to better outcomes.

Revolutionizing Clinical Trials with AI-Enabled Automation

Artificial intelligence (AI) is poised to transform the landscape of clinical trials, ushering in a new era of efficiency and precision. By automating manual tasks such as data entry, patient screening, and trial management, AI empowers researchers to expedite the trial process. AI-powered algorithms can also analyze vast datasets with remarkable speed and accuracy, uncovering hidden patterns that may lead to breakthrough discoveries.

  • Moreover, AI can personalize treatment plans based on individual patient characteristics, leading to more effective therapeutic interventions.
  • Also, AI-enabled chatbots and virtual assistants can offer patients with 24/7 support and guidance, improving participation in clinical trials.

The integration of AI into clinical trials holds immense promise to accelerate medical research, improve patient outcomes, and ultimately extend lives.

Developing Safer and More Effective Drugs with AI-Assisted Research

The pharmaceutical industry is transforming the drug discovery process through the integration of artificial intelligence (AI). Experts are leveraging AI algorithms to scrutinize massive datasets of biological and chemical information, pinpointing potential drug candidates with enhanced efficacy and safety. AI-powered tools can simulate the interactions between drugs and target molecules, shortening the development cycle and reducing the expense of bringing new therapies to market. This alliance between human expertise and AI technology holds significant promise for creating safer and more effective drugs that treat a wider range of diseases.

  • AI algorithms can scrutinize complex biological data to identify potential drug targets.
  • Deep learning can be used to predict the effectiveness and safety of drug candidates.
  • AI-powered tools can represent the interactions between drugs and target molecules, providing valuable insights into their mechanisms of action.
